What are the 5cs of Indra Nooyi?

Indra Nooyi, the former CEO of PepsiCo, is renowned for her leadership style and strategic vision. Her 5Cs framework—competence, courage, confidence, communication, and compass—offers a blueprint for effective leadership. This approach has been pivotal in her success and can be applied universally to enhance personal and professional growth.

What Are the 5Cs of Indra Nooyi?

Indra Nooyi’s 5Cs of leadership are a set of principles that guide effective decision-making and personal development. These principles include competence, courage, confidence, communication, and compass. Each "C" represents a critical trait that leaders should cultivate to navigate challenges and drive success.

Competence: Building Expertise and Skills

Competence refers to the necessary skills and knowledge required to perform a job effectively. Nooyi emphasizes the importance of continuous learning and improvement to stay relevant and excel in one’s field.

  • Develop Expertise: Focus on acquiring and refining skills relevant to your industry.
  • Stay Updated: Keep abreast of industry trends and innovations.
  • Seek Feedback: Regularly ask for constructive criticism to identify areas for improvement.

Courage: Taking Bold Steps

Courage involves the ability to make tough decisions and take risks when necessary. Nooyi believes that leaders must be willing to step out of their comfort zones to drive innovation and progress.

  • Embrace Risk: Don’t shy away from challenges that could lead to growth.
  • Stand Firm: Make decisions based on values and principles, even when faced with opposition.
  • Lead by Example: Demonstrate resilience and determination in difficult situations.

Confidence: Trusting Yourself and Others

Confidence is about having faith in your abilities and the capabilities of your team. Nooyi stresses the importance of self-assurance in fostering a positive and productive work environment.

  • Self-Belief: Trust in your skills and judgment.
  • Empower Others: Encourage team members to take initiative and share ideas.
  • Celebrate Successes: Acknowledge achievements to build morale and motivation.

Communication: Clear and Effective Interaction

Communication is the cornerstone of successful leadership. Nooyi highlights the need for transparent and inclusive communication to build trust and collaboration.

  • Be Clear: Articulate your vision and goals succinctly.
  • Listen Actively: Pay attention to feedback and concerns from your team.
  • Foster Open Dialogue: Create an environment where everyone feels comfortable sharing their thoughts.

Compass: Guiding with Integrity

Compass refers to having a strong ethical foundation and a clear sense of direction. Nooyi underscores the importance of integrity and values in guiding decisions and actions.

  • Define Your Values: Identify the principles that matter most to you.
  • Stay True: Ensure your actions align with your ethical standards.
  • Lead with Purpose: Make decisions that reflect your long-term vision and mission.

What is Indra Nooyi known for?

Indra Nooyi is best known for her tenure as CEO of PepsiCo, where she led the company through significant growth and transformation. She is recognized for her strategic vision, emphasis on sustainability, and innovative leadership style.

How did Indra Nooyi impact PepsiCo?

During her leadership, Nooyi focused on diversifying PepsiCo’s product portfolio, emphasizing healthier options, and expanding the company’s global footprint. Her initiatives helped increase revenue and positioned PepsiCo as a leader in the food and beverage industry.
